Quoting Schöke, Karsten (2024-12-30 13:16:17) > I'm pretty new to the Debian bug tracker and packaging. > > How can I change the packaging name in an existing ITP in wnpp? > > Or should I open a new request? You can change the title of the bugreport from "ITP: redfish ..." ti "ITP: python-redfish ...". I find it easiest to do such metadata operations on Debian bugreports using the command-line tool "bts" part of the Debian package devscripts.
